How to add this emoji

Add to Discord
  1. Click Download PNG above to save the arrow image.
  2. Open Discord and go to Server Settings → Emoji.
  3. Click Upload Emoji and choose the downloaded file.
  4. Give it a name and save. You need the Manage Emojis and Stickers permission.
